ك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

Ubuntu 18.04 LTS هو الإصدار الثابت الحالي لنظام التشغيل Linux من Canonical. إنها تحتوي على الكثير من البرامج الحديثة بفضل جهود backporting . على الرغم من ذلك ، يميل المستخدمون إلى التعثر في إصدار قديم من Linux kernel.

ليس الأمر سيئًا للغاية أن تكون على Ubuntu LTS وتظل عالقًا مع إصدار أقدم من Linux kernel ، حيث يبذل المطورون قصارى جهدهم لإصلاح المنافذ والتحسينات في المستقبل. ومع ذلك ، إذا كنت تستخدم 18.04 بسبب أغراض الاستقرار ، ولكنك تفضل استخدام أحدث وأكبر نواة Linux (مثل kernel 5 ،) فسوف تنزعج قليلاً. لحسن الحظ ، نظرًا لمجتمع Linux ، أصبح من السهل بشكل متزايد استخدام Linux kernel 5 على Ubuntu 18.04 LTS

الطريقة الأولى - مع UKUU

Ubuntu Kernel Upgrade Utility هو المسار الأكثر مباشرة للحصول على Linux يستخدم Linux kernel 5 على Ubuntu 18.04 LTS. للوصول إلى التطبيق ، ستحتاج إلى التوجه إلى دليلنا حول كيفية تثبيت تطبيق UKUU .

بمجرد حصولك على تطبيق UKUU الذي يعمل على Ubuntu ، قم بتشغيله من خلال استعراضه في قائمة التطبيق الخاصة بك. بعد ذلك ، استخدم تطبيق UKUU لتحديد الإصدار 5 من Linux kernel (يفضل أحدث إصدار متاح).

حدد الإصدار 5 kernel الذي ترغب في تثبيته على Ubuntu 18.04 LTS باستخدام الماوس لتمييزه. بعد ذلك ، ابدأ تثبيت النواة الجديدة بالنقر فوق الزر "تثبيت" لتحميلها على نظامك.

ك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

اسمح لتطبيق UKUU بتنزيل الإصدار 5 من Linux kernel وتثبيته بالكامل على كمبيوتر Ubuntu Linux. عند اكتمال عملية التثبيت ، أغلق تطبيق UKUU وأعد تشغيل Ubuntu 18.04 LTS. عند إعادة التمهيد ، يجب أن تستخدم الإصدار 5 من Linux kernel.

هل تريد التأكد من أنك تقوم بتشغيل أحدث إصدار مطلق من النواة وأن UKUU تعمل على النحو المنشود؟ قم بتشغيل نافذة طرفية بالضغط على  Ctrl + Alt + T  أو  Ctrl + Shift + T واكتب:

uname -r

الطريقة الثانية - من المصدر

تعد Ubuntu Kernel Update Utility أداة جيدة ، ولكن نظرًا لأنها تعمل عادةً مع إصدارات Linux kernel قيد التطوير بواسطة Canonical ، فقد تكون الأمور غير مستقرة بعض الشيء. للحصول على حل أكثر استقرارًا ، يمكنك تجميع Linux بنفسك.

لبدء عملية التجميع ، تحتاج إلى إنشاء ملف تكوين جديد. الطريقة الأسرع والأكثر مباشرة للقيام بذلك هي تنزيل ملف التكوين الحالي الذي قمنا بإعداده.

ملاحظة: ألا تريد استخدام ملف التكوين المحدد مسبقًا؟ انسخ ملفًا موجودًا من التمهيد واحفظه باسم ".config."

wget https://pastebin.com/raw/Pwz0Uyqn -O .config

بعد تنزيل ملف التكوين ، حان الوقت لتنزيل أحدث إصدار من Linux kernel. حتى كتابة هذا المقال ، الإصدار 5.0.8.

ملاحظة: يتم نشر إصدارات kernel بانتظام على Kernel.org. إذا كنت ترغب في التحديث من 5.0.8 في المستقبل ، توجه إلى هناك ، وقم بتنزيل المصدر الجديد واتبع التعليمات الواردة في هذا الدليل.

wget https://cdn.kernel.org/pub/linux/kernel/v5.x/linux-5.0.8.tar.xz

قم باستخراج أرشيف 5.0.8 kernel باستخدام الأمر Tar.

tar xvf linux-5.0.8.tar.xz

انقل ملف التكوين الجديد إلى مجلد كود Linux باستخدام الأمر mv .

mv .config ~ / لينكس 5.0.8 /

قم بتثبيت تبعيات بناء kernel على Ubuntu ، بحيث يمكن تجميعها وبنائها.

sudo apt install build-basic libncurses5-dev دول مجلس التعاون الخليجي libssl-dev bc flex bison

قم بتشغيل أداة قائمة واجهة المستخدم الرسومية للنواة باستخدام تكوين menuconfig

ك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

القرص المضغوط ~ / لينكس 5.0.8 /

جعل menuconfig

في تطبيق القائمة ، اترك كل شيء على الإعدادات الافتراضية واستخدم مفاتيح الأسهم لتحديد "حفظ". تأكد من كتابة الملف إلى ".config."

اخرج من أداة القائمة بتحديد "خروج".

بمجرد خروجك من محرر قائمة واجهة المستخدم الرسومية ، حان الوقت لاستخدام الأمر lscpu لمعرفة عدد النوى الموجودة في جهاز الكمبيوتر الخاص بك ، لتحديد عدد وحدات المعالجة المركزية التي يمكن استخدامها لتجميع النواة.

لمعرفة عدد النوى لديك ، قم بتشغيل:

lscpu | grep -E '^ CPU \ ('

ضع هذا الرقم في الاعتبار. بعد ذلك ، استخدم make مع الأمر deb-pkg لبدء تجميع Ubuntu. تأكد من تغيير "CORE-NUMBER" بالرقم الذي يظهر عند تشغيل أمر lscpu .

جعل -jCORE-NUMBER deb-pkg ك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

اعتمادًا على عدد نوى وحدة المعالجة المركزية لديك ، سيستغرق جهازك وقتًا طويلاً جدًا. للحصول على أفضل النتائج ، حاول البناء على وحدة معالجة مركزية ثنائية النواة على الأقل (2). عند الانتهاء من عملية البناء ، سيخرج المترجم أربع حزم جاهزة للانتقال إلى DEB للنواة الجديدة حتى تتمكن من تثبيتها.

لتثبيت نواة Linux 5.0.8 المترجمة حديثًا ، قم بتشغيل الأمر dpkg .

ك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

sudo dpkg -i linux - *. deb

بافتراض تثبيت dpkg بنجاح ، أعد تشغيل كمبيوتر Linux الخاص بك. عندما يعود الاتصال بالإنترنت ، يجب أن تقوم بتشغيل Ubuntu 18.04 LTS على Linux kernel الإصدار 5.

لتأكيد أنك تقوم بالفعل بتشغيل kernel 5 على Ubuntu 18.04 LTS ، استخدم الأمر uname .

كيفية استخدام Linux kernel 5 على Ubuntu 18.04 LTS

uname -r


تحسين حافظة Gnome Shell باستخدام Pano

تحسين حافظة Gnome Shell باستخدام Pano

دعونا نواجه الأمر ، فإن حافظة Gnome Shell الافتراضية ليست جيدة جدًا. قم بتثبيت Pano لتحسين تجربة الحافظة الخاصة بك!

كيفية تثبيت DaVinci Resolve 17 على نظام Linux

كيفية تثبيت DaVinci Resolve 17 على نظام Linux

هل تحتاج إلى محرر فيديو غير خطي رائع لمربع Linux الخاص بك؟ احصل على Davinci Resolve 17 بالعمل باستخدام هذا الدليل!

كيفية تنزيل الخلفيات على سطح مكتب Linux باستخدام برنامج Wallpaper Downloader

كيفية تنزيل الخلفيات على سطح مكتب Linux باستخدام برنامج Wallpaper Downloader

Wallpaper Downloader هو أداة تنزيل ومدير خلفية رائعة لنظام Linux. وهو يدعم معظم بيئات سطح مكتب Linux وهو سهل الاستخدام للغاية. هذا الدليل

كيفية تثبيت نظام التشغيل Tuxedo OS على جهاز الكمبيوتر الخاص بك

كيفية تثبيت نظام التشغيل Tuxedo OS على جهاز الكمبيوتر الخاص بك

هل تريد اختبار Tuxedo OS بواسطة أجهزة كمبيوتر Tuxedo؟ تعرف على كيفية الحصول على أحدث إصدار من Tuxedo OS يعمل على جهاز الكمبيوتر الخاص بك.

كيفية تثبيت ملف DEB على نظام Linux

كيفية تثبيت ملف DEB على نظام Linux

ما هو ملف DEB؟ ماذا تفعل به؟ تعرف على العديد من الطرق التي يمكنك من خلالها تثبيت ملفات DEB على جهاز كمبيوتر يعمل بنظام Linux.

كيف تلعب Dying Light على Linux

كيف تلعب Dying Light على Linux

Dying Light هي لعبة فيديو رعب للبقاء على قيد الحياة لعام 2015 تم تطويرها بواسطة Techland ونشرتها شركة Warner Bros Interactive Entertainment. تركز اللعبة على

كيفية تثبيت Neptune Linux على جهاز الكمبيوتر الخاص بك

كيفية تثبيت Neptune Linux على جهاز الكمبيوتر الخاص بك

يستخدم Neptune بيئة سطح المكتب KDE Plasma 5 ويهدف إلى تقديم نظام تشغيل أنيق. إليك كيفية تثبيت Neptune Linux على جهاز الكمبيوتر الخاص بك.

جرب سطح مكتب Ubuntu الجديد المستند إلى Snap

جرب سطح مكتب Ubuntu الجديد المستند إلى Snap

هل تريد تجربة نظام تشغيل سطح المكتب الجديد المستند إلى الحزمة الإضافية Ubuntus؟ تعرف على كيفية نشره على جهاز افتراضي باستخدام هذا الدليل.

كيف تلعب Undertale على Linux

كيف تلعب Undertale على Linux

Undertale هي لعبة RPG مستقلة ثنائية الأبعاد لعام 2015 تم تطويرها ونشرها بواسطة مطور الألعاب Toby Fox. سيغطي هذا الدليل تنزيل وتثبيت Undertale على جهازك

كيف تلعب Total War: THREE KingdomS على Linux

كيف تلعب Total War: THREE KingdomS على Linux

Total War: Three Kingdoms هي لعبة استراتيجية تعتمد على تبادل الأدوار تم تطويرها بواسطة Creative Assembly. هيريس كيف تلعب على لينكس.